The XAO::Web module before 1.84 for Perl mishandles < and > characters in JSON output during use of json-embed in Web::Action.

Plain-English summary

CVE-2020-36827 affects Perl applications using XAO::Web before 1.84. When JSON is embedded through Web::Action json-embed, angle brackets may not be handled safely, creating a browser-side injection risk if attacker-controlled content is included.

Executive priority

Treat this as a targeted remediation item, not an emergency. Prioritize internet-facing or authenticated user-facing Perl applications that use XAO::Web json-embed with user-supplied data.

Technical view

The issue is improper handling of < and > characters in JSON output generated by XAO::Web json-embed in Web::Action. The CVSS 3.1 score is 5.4, network-reachable, low complexity, low privileges required, with low confidentiality and integrity impact.

Likely exposure

Exposure is likely limited to Perl applications that depend on XAO::Web before version 1.84 and use Web::Action json-embed with content that may include user-controlled values.

Exploitation context

The provided sources do not show active exploitation, and the CVE is not listed as KEV. Practical risk depends on whether untrusted input reaches embedded JSON rendered by a browser.

Researcher notes

Evidence is narrow but consistent: the CVE description, affected version boundary, and upstream references point to unsafe angle-bracket handling in embedded JSON. No exploit status or broader affected product list is provided.

Mitigation direction

  • Upgrade XAO::Web to version 1.84 or later.
  • Review the upstream commit and changelog for the exact vendor fix.
  • Reduce or remove json-embed use for untrusted content until upgraded.
  • Retest pages that embed JSON into browser-rendered HTML.

Validation and detection

  • Inventory Perl dependencies for XAO::Web versions before 1.84.
  • Search application code for Web::Action json-embed usage.
  • Trace whether user-controlled values can reach embedded JSON output.
  • Confirm upgraded deployments no longer use the vulnerable module version.
